Anyway I don't see the exact problem you may find in this case. There
are other stacked diacritics in this document (such as breve plus
acute accent), and there's probably no need to encode them in a
precombined form, and which problem it would solve. The good question
will be to find fonts or renderers that will correctly render those
unusual stacks (of a combining letter plus a combining diacritic, over
another base letter).
